  4. 4. Confirmation Bias in Criminal Cases

    Författare :Moa Lidén; Minna Gräns; Peter Juslin; Steven Penrod; Uppsala universitet; []
    Nyckelord :SAMHÄLLSVETENSKAP; SOCIAL SCIENCES; SAMHÄLLSVETENSKAP; SOCIAL SCIENCES; legal decision making; bias; confirmation bias; criminal cases; criminal procedure; police; prosecutor; judge; legal system; empirical legal research; evidence based law; debiasing technique; Jurisprudence; Allmän rättslära;

    Sammanfattning : Confirmation bias is a tendency to selectively search for and emphasize information that is consistent with a preferred hypothesis, whereas opposing information is ignored or downgraded. This thesis examines the role of confirmation bias in criminal cases, primarily focusing on the Swedish legal setting. LÄS MER
